Simeon’s cries felt distant as he fell from the realm he once called ‘home’. Why? Why did it have to turn out this way? What did he do wrong? Was he that... useless? Even Michael couldn’t believe his ears when he heard that Luke was going to be banished. He had done nothing, and could even rival what angels higher in the hierarchy are capable of. Useless was anything but what Luke is. 
He was told by Simeon to go straight to the brothers, or at least Diavolo and Barbatos. Oh gosh, Simeon’s face... Luke had never seen it before. It was so void of the happiness he was used to seeing. Right then, it was so full of grief and despair, and Luke felt so sorry that he was the cause of it. The face that once gave Luke hope was now shattered, and the only thing he could hold onto was the comfort Simeon’s eyes revealed - telling him that everything was going to be alright. Luke disliked the demons, but even he had to admit he could tolerate them and in this situation, it would be best to trust them.
He was expecting to hit the ground when he was caught by arms that felt so strong and warm. 
“Luke, what are you doing here? Why did you fall fro-” Lucifer asked the younger before cutting himself off, his realization hitting him. Luke’s wails gave away that he was in deep agony and although Lucifer didn’t really like him that much, those wails felt like stabs, so wrong coming from this child who used to be so pure.
Luke held onto Lucifer as if his life depended on him, which it probably did considering that if Lucifer wasn’t there he might’ve already been gone. Lucifer adjusted Luke’s position into a more comfortable one, comforting him the way he used to comfort his brothers when they fell from the Celestial Realm. He tucked Luke’s head into the crook of his neck and rushed to the Demon Lord’s castle.
-
He woke up with a cry as pain shot up his back and he was hurriedly laid back down by a pair of arms. He opened his eyes slightly to see the person before he let out another sob.
“Lu...ci..fer?” he croaked out. 
“Yes, it’s me, Luke,” Lucifer sighed out in relief. He wouldn’t admit it, but he’d been worried sick Luke might not wake up. “You’re in one of the bedrooms in Lord Diavolo’s castle right now. Barbatos will be coming in soon to check in on you.”
Luke let out a strangled noise as he tried to nod. Lucifer shushed him and checked over Luke once more and his breath caught in his throat. Where his back was once bare now grew tattered and dark feathers, indicating that his wings were going to grow sooner or later. His horns might grow then as well. 
As he was looking over Luke, Barbatos came in as if he was in a rush, and it seems as if he was. 
“Oh, Luke,” Barbatos whispered is horror. The butler had taken a liking to Luke, and when the exchange program ended, the younger didn’t hold back any tears as he hung onto Barbatos. 
The butler then brought in his signature cake and Luke lightened up a bit, which made both the older demons smile sadly. Barbatos gave Luke a slice of the cake and offered one to Lucifer as well, which he accepted when he glanced at Luke.
“Ugh, I missed your cake, Barbatos! I kept trying to make it but it wouldn’t taste the same!” Luke groaned and made Barbatos chuckle slightly. He and Lucifer then exchanged eye contact.
“Lord Diavolo suggests that Luke stays at the House of Lamentation, if you don’t mind,” Barbatos told Lucifer to which he sighed in response.
“I’ve thought so, my brothers are already making a room ready for you,” he said as he looked at Luke and he widened his eyes.
“If it’s fine. I really don’t want to burden any of you! I’m already doing so by-”
“Luke, they’ve already made a room for you. You won’t be burdening us,” chastised Lucifer.
Luke stared at Lucifer before giggling softly. “I now see why MC used to call you an over-bearing mother.”
Lucifer pulled a face at the thought of that as he sighed in exasperation. 
“Lucifer, can you give me and Luke some time alone, please?’ 
Lucifer looked between the two and nodded as he sat up and left. He could guess that Luke still wasn’t alright, and he wouldn’t be the best at that. Besides, Luke and Barbatos had a bond much stronger. 
As Lucifer left, the tears he had been holding in started falling from his eyes. Barbatos then slowly took the plate of cake and placed it on the table and sat down on the bed, and ever so gently he lead the boy forward until Luke was pressed up against his side and wrapped up in his arms. The sobs Luke let out were heart-breaking and his small chest was heaving heavily, struggling to breathe. Barbatos then suddenly had an idea, and he the placed Luke’s head on his chest.
“ Come Little Children,
I'll take thee away,
Into a land of enchantment.”
The butler’s calm and low voice quieted Luke, but he was still hiccuping and tears were still running down his face. “Come Little Children,
Times come to play,
Here in my garden of shadows.” Barbatos has never despised the angels more than this moment (except maybe Simeon). Rest assured, this “garden of shadow” would be the safest place Luke can live without being banished just because some angel thought he was weak and useless. “Follow sweet children,
I'll show thee the way,
Through all the pain and the sorrows.” The butler is sure that in time, the brothers and the young Lord will be able to help Luke through all this. He’s too young after all, and this will impact him forever. “Weep not poor children,
For life is this way,
Murdering Beauty and Passions.” Alas, out of all the realities he’s seen this one may have been the most unpredictable of all. But - he guesses, life isn’t always about beauty and happiness. “Hush now my children,
It must be this way,
Too wary of life and deception.” Luke was never really deceived in a way so cruel, so harsh for beings who live in the Celestial Realm. So maybe it was because of that even though he distrusts easily, he places his confidence and kindness in many people, the young Lord can confirm that. “Rest now my children,
For soon we'll away,
Into the calm and the quiet.” Barbatos finally felt Luke slump against him and he brushed his lips against the younger one’s hair. 
“Do not worry, Simeon. We will take care of Luke and one day you two will be reunited again. This is a reality I am going to make happen.”
